Croatia - Apples Yield

Since 2014, Croatia Apples Yield fell by 3.2% year on year. At 138,081 Hectograms Per Hectare in 2019, the country was number 44 among other countries in Apples Yield. Croatia is overtaken by Mexico, which was number 43 at 143,728 Hectograms Per Hectare and is followed by Czech Republic with 135,929 Hectograms Per Hectare. New Zealand ranked the highest with 567,219 Hectograms Per Hectare in 2019, +1.6% versus 2018. Switzerland, Chile and Belgium resp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Estonia witnessed the best average annual growth at +32.7% per year, while Montenegro witnessed the worst performance at -19.6% per year.
